Engine Specifications
Engine: 383 cu in (6.3 L) MEL V8
Displacement: 383 cu in (6.3 L)
Horsepower: 322 HP
Torque: 460 lb-ft
Compression Ratio: 10.0:1
Ignition System: Conventional points ignition system
Cooling System: Liquid-cooled
Performance Specifications
0-60 Time: Estimated 9 seconds
1/4 Mile Time: Estimated 16 seconds
Top Speed: 115 mph
Transmission and Drive
Drive Type: Rear-wheel drive
Transmission Type: 3-speed Merc-O-Matic automatic
Fuel and Efficiency
Fuel System Type: Carburetor
MPG: Estimated 10-12 mpg
Dimensions and Brakes
Brakes: Drum brakes
Wheelbase: 126 inches
Weight: 4,000 lbs

Design and Innovation

The 1959 Mercury Monterey captured attention with its sweeping lines and bold contours. Its exterior styling was a harmonious blend of elegance and audacity, featuring a prominent grille and daring tailfins that were all the rage at the time. The car's interior was equally impressive, boasting high-quality materials that included plush upholstery options and well-crafted trimmings. Technological advancements were evident in features like power-operated seats and windows—a luxury in those days.

Color options for the Monterey ranged from classic whites and blacks to more vibrant hues that mirrored the era's fascination with color. Among these, shades like "Tahitian Green" and "Sunset Orchid" were particularly popular, adding to the vehicle's allure. The Monterey came in various body styles, including sedans, coupes, and convertibles, with the convertible often hailed as the most iconic embodiment of this model's spirit.

Ownership Experience

Owners of the 1959 Mercury Monterey typically reveled in its dual role as both a reliable daily driver and an eye-catching show car. Its maintenance profile was generally straightforward, thanks to shared components with other Ford models of the time, making repairs manageable for the average owner. However, like many vehicles from this period, it required more frequent attention than modern cars.

Collector's Information

Today's collector market sees the 1959 Mercury Monterey as a desirable piece due to its distinctive styling and representation of 1950s Americana. While production numbers were significant for the time, surviving examples in excellent condition are relatively scarce. Values range widely based on condition but can climb significantly for well-preserved or expertly restored models—often fetching anywhere from $20,000 to $60,000 or more at auction.
